1-Pentanesulfonic acid

Base Information Edit
  • Chemical Name:1-Pentanesulfonic acid
  • CAS No.:35452-30-3
  • Molecular Formula:C5H12O3S
  • Molecular Weight:152.214
  • Hs Code.:2904100000
  • DSSTox Substance ID:DTXSID90188967
  • Nikkaji Number:J323.649H
  • Wikidata:Q83060851
  • Mol file:35452-30-3.mol
1-Pentanesulfonic acid

Synonyms:1-pentanesulfonic acid;1-pentanesulfonic acid, sodium salt;sodium 1-pentanesulfonate

Chemical Property of 1-Pentanesulfonic acid Edit
Chemical Property:
  • Refractive Index:1.46 
  • PSA:62.75000 
  • Density:1.174 g/cm3 
  • LogP:2.14520 
  • XLogP3:0.9
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:3
  • Rotatable Bond Count:4
  • Exact Mass:152.05071541
  • Heavy Atom Count:9
  • Complexity:142
